计算机毕业设计 php短租平台 毕设

演示视频:


https://www.bilibili.com/video/BV1dz421f7bH/

3.1系统模块划分

产品短租发布交易平台系统将采用B\S网站架构进行设计,主要有三大部分组成,前端内容页面显示,后台系统管理,以及个人中心管理系统三大部分组成。通过三个部分系统的建立,我们将实现个人闲置产品短租形式发布、展品展示、签订租赁产品租赁订单、确认支付信息、设备发送等等一系列功能。

3.2 功能描述

前端页面显示,主要包含有首页面,具有主题广告滚动图片、热点租赁产品、分类租赁产品,用于展示重点为推荐的租赁产品,通过租赁的主题产品和主题内容信息使大家对于特殊环境对于租品的应用方式和使用方式得到认知。通过宣传租赁产品的意义,让大家更倾向于租赁产品。用户可以通过租赁产品的信息具体描述,了解产品以及租赁产品的价格,来决定是否确认订单,当选定租期,订单会自动计算租期价格和押金价格,当租赁用户确认订单并且支付金额后,租品将按要求邮寄到租赁用户指定的地址。

个人中心管理系统部分主要包含个人用户的注册登录,然后才可以自行发布租赁产品的信息,管理自己的租品,对需要租赁产品下订单,形成订单付款后,即可等待租品,然后使用后对租品进行退回,系统扣除租金后退回押金,完成租赁流程,且可以对所租产品进行评论。对所发布租品进行订单管理,接收租赁订单,且对租赁产品进行确认,邮寄处理、退回确认等操作,收取租金,租金将有系统平台账户统一管理。

后台系统管理部分主要包含管理员权限管理、用户系统管理、专题文章发布管理、租品管理(所有的)、订单的查看和审核、系统备份等。







3.3系统的概要设计

产品短租发布交易平台系统将充分发挥互联网平台的优势,以高可靠性,可移植性,跨平台性、经济性作为系统运营服务运行平台以及开发语言的选择前提。

在服务器操作系统上,我们选择了商业公司较为流行使用的CentOS系统, CentOS系统可选择移去与服务器无关的功能进行简约方式的安装,系统小巧但确非常稳定,命令行模式操作可以方便管理系统和应用,同时其有着强大的中英文开放文档与开发者社区的支持,使得遇到问题可以更好的解决。

Web服务器的种类很多,有较为著名的Apache,以及后起之秀Nginx。Apache具有出色的稳定性能,可以提供静态和动态的页面服务,且对于PHP的解析不是通过性能较差的CGI来实现的,而是通过自己模块来实现对PHP的支持。但Apache的服务请求是基于多进程的HTTPServer,它需要对每个用户访问创建一个子进程进行响应,对于这样的缺点,当并发的访问请求增多时就会创建非常多的子进程,从而占用极多的系统资源CPU和内存。因此对于并发处理不是Apache的强项。 随着访问量的增多Apache将成为瓶颈,而Nginx的优点在于速度快,轻量级,在处理多用户并发方面要大大优于Apache服务器,可以很轻松的支撑大型门户网站的大访问量。因此我们通常可以把Nginx作为反向代理服务器放置到多台的Apache Web服务器前段,来一方面缓存数据,另一方面实现多台服务器的负载均衡。

当然对于系统运行平台来说,随着云端服务器模式高速发展和性能的不断提高,我们可以通过租赁阿里云等方式来解决运行平台的问题,这样可以降低我们的维护工作量,且拥有一个高性能,稳定的系统服务运行解决方案。。

3.4 系统的总体模块结构设计

系统总体功能模块图如图3-2所示:

 021f78c3fd762d4b126b2a7db561fcd7.jpeg

图3-2 系统功能模块图

3.5系统流程分析

为了进一步了解本实例系统的设计,本小节将对系统进行流程分析。多用户系统的工作流程都是从用户登录模块开始,对用户的身份进行认证。身份认证可以分为以下两个过程:

0232352b843e8ef238b704d16ef2b72c.jpeg

                        图3-3 后台系统的流程分析图

流程图如图3-8所示:

f0961c37adbc74489706e92316b5ec76.jpeg

图3-8总流程图


  • 3
    点赞
  • 7
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

言宇程序

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值